Output 25a37ff6ab524ff8e1896b450f63db32a71df84b5866896fefceb92ad8c25ce6:1

value
5890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62cbf98d0a702fc177d4420d792050ffe245979e OP_EQUAL
address
A1SfEcB6QfFuK43LNxHzB8meZzRbwjDvvy
transaction
25a37ff6ab524ff8e1896b450f63db32a71df84b5866896fefceb92ad8c25ce6